Product Overview The Juniper Networks QFX3500 Switch delivers a high-performance, ultra low latency, feature rich Layer 2 and Layer 3 solution for the most demanding data center environments. Featuring standards-based Fibre Channel I/O and iSCSI convergence capabilities in a compact form factor, the QFX3500 is a versatile, high density 10GbE platform that also delivers a fabric-ready edge solution for the Juniper Networks QFabric architecture. Product Description The high-performance Juniper Networks® QFX3500 Switch addresses a wide range of deployment scenarios, which include traditional data centers, virtualized data centers, high-performance computing, network-attached and iSCSI storage, FCoE convergence, and cloud computing. Featuring 48 dual-mode small form-factor pluggable transceiver (SFP+/SFP) ports and four quad small form-factor pluggable plus (QSFP+) ports in a 1 U form factor, the QFX3500 Switch delivers feature rich Layer 2 and Layer 3 connectivity to networked devices such as rack servers, blade servers, storage systems, and other switches in highly demanding, high-performance data center environments. For end-to-end convergence, the QFX3500 has extensive DCB capabilities including specific iSCSI support. For FCoEbased converged server edge access environments, the QFX3500 is also a standardsbased Fibre Channel over Ethernet (FCoE) Transit Switch and FCoE to Fibre Channel (FCoE-FC) Gateway, enabling customers to protect their investments in existing data center aggregation and Fibre Channel storage area network (SAN) infrastructures. The Juniper Networks QFX3500 is a highly flexible data center switch that offers several deployment options including Fabric, Virtual Chassis and MC-LAG. When deployed with other components of the Juniper Networks QFabric™ family, including the QFX3100 QFabric Director and the QFX3600-I QFabric Interconnect (in a QFX3000-M QFabric System) or QFX3008-I QFabric Interconnect (in a QFX3000-G QFabric System), the QFX3500 delivers a fabric-ready edge solution that contributes to a highperformance, low latency, single-tier data center fabric. By converting any 10GbE or 40GbE port into a Virtual Chassis connection, the QFX3500 can leverage all the benefits of Juniper’s industry-leading Virtual Chassis technology including simplified management and operations, as well as high availability. As a leaf node in Juniper’s new Virtual Chassis Fabric architecture, the QFX3500 switch offers deterministic rack-to-rack throughput, high availability and a smooth transition path from 1GbE to 10/40GbE. The QFX3500 can be deployed along with with Juniper QFX3600, EX4300 and QFX5100 switches in the same Virtual Chassis and Virtual Chassis Fabric configuration. For added configuration flexibility, up to 36 of the QFX3500’s 48 pluggable SFP+ ports can be used in 10GbE or 1GbE mode with up to 18 of the 1GbE ports being copper. The remaining 12 ports can be used to support 2, 4, or 8 Gbps Fibre Channel modes as well as 10GbE. Each of the four QSFP+ high speed ports can operate in 4x10GbE mode and are capable of supporting 40 Gbps optics* in the future, providing investment protection.

High-Performance DCB, Storage, and I/O Convergence Deployments The QFX3500 is a fully IEEE DCB- and T11 FC-BB-5-based FCoE Transit Switch and FCoE-FC Gateway, delivering a high-performance solution for converged server edge access environments. The QFX3500 provides configurable ports capable of 1GbE, 10GbE, and 2/4/8 Gbps FC connectivity. Exchange Market data MX80 feed WAN, NAT, 1588 • FCoE Transit Switch: As an FCoE Transit Switch, the QFX3500 provides a pure IEEE DCB converged access layer between FCoEenabled servers and an FCoE-enabled Fibre Channel SAN (see Figure 4, Scenario 1). • Insight Technology for Analytics: The QFX3500 provides dynamic buffer utilization monitoring and reporting with an interval of 10 milliseconds to provide microburst and latency insight. It calculates both queue depth and latency, and logs messages when configured thresholds are crossed. Interface traffic statistics can be monitored at two-second granularity. The data can be viewed via CLI, system log, or streamed to external servers for more analysis. Supported reporting formats include Java Script Object Notification (JSON), CSV and TSV.
